SS Saxonia Passenger List - 19 July 1910

First Page, Cunard Line SS Saxonia Saloon Class Passenger List - 19 July 1910

First Page, Saloon Class Passenger List from the SS Saxonia of the Cunard Line, Departing Tuesday, 19 July 1910 from Boston to Liverpool, Commanded by Captain Arthur H. Rostron, Printed in the 27 July 1910 Cunard Daily Bulletin, Saxonia Edition. | GGA Image ID # 132e801bfb

Senior Officers and Staff

  • Commander: Arthur H. Rostron

Summary

  • Saloon (First Class): 87 (86 + maid)
  • Second Class: 307
  • Third Class: 381
  • Crew: 278
  • Total on Board: 1,053
